Qualifications for elders and/or deacons
1 Tim. 3
Titus 1
Paul's thorn in the flesh and Christ's strength "made perfect" in weakness
2 Cor. 12
Hagar and Sarah symbolize the earthly and the heavenly Jerusalem.
Gal. 4
One of Paul's "lists" of spiritual gifts
1 Cor. 12
Rom. 12
The problem of lawsuit among believers
1 Cor. 6
Christ humbled, becoming obedient to death on the cross
Phil. 2:8
Paul corrects the abuse of the Lord's Supper
1 Cor. 11
There is no one righteous, not even one
Rom. 3
Put on the whole armor of God
Eph. 6
Christ is the image of the invisible God
Col. 1:15
Paul has learned the secret of being content in every circumstance
Phil. 4
